SKEWBITS is an original puzzle game designed specifically for 3D printing. Fit the four unique Skewbits into various silhouettes. You may be surprised by how challenging some of the problems can be! Watch my video to learn more Basic Rules Fit the 4 hinged Skewbits within each outline. You do not have to fill every space, but most solutions will. Only use the Skewbits right side up. You may not flip the parts upside down ------------------------------------------ This download includes the grid and puzzle pieces, premium upgrades, problems 001-040, and a solution guide PDF. ------------------------------------------ Printing Guidelines Grid.stl : Your usual print settings should work fine. I used 15% infill, 5 top layers, 0.2mm layer height. Optionally, swap filament above 1.2mm to make the grid stand out. Skewbits A-D : 2-3 perimeters, 0.16mm layer height. No supports. Proper extrusion is important to ensure the print-in-place hinges are sturdy without fusing together (Clearance is 0.3mm). Use the colors indicated by the filenames if you want to match the solution guide. Prints right side up Grid_TPUgrip.stl : Optional grip for the bottom of the grid. Print solid using Ninjaflex TPU (Also on Amazon) or similar. Glue in place using E6000 adhesive, etc. Grid_LaserGrip.svg : Optional grip for the bottom of the grid. Designed for lasercutting. I used 3mm cork. Watch my video for details. Problems (001.stl-040.stl) : Print solid, 2 perimeters, 0.22mm layer height*NOTE: The default orientation of this puzzle is to print upside-down (so any squash on the first layers doesn't affect fit). Make sure you orient correctly when playing the game! The puzzle number is embossed on the bottom side of each problem, make sure it's upright. You can use a filament swap or mark the bottom with markers if you need to make things more clear.* Premium Board + Case : This is an upgraded version of the SKEWBITS board. The thicker board snaps onto the various cases which can be used to store SKEWBITS problems. There is also a cover that snaps over the top of the board, so you can store all the bits in one nice package. The cover can be printed blank, or use multipass printing to include the logo on the lid using the LogoA.stl and LogoB.stl versions of the cover. The 'thin' cover can be used to close the problem containers instead of the Premium board. This is useful if you have a lot of skewbits problems, so they can be stored in multiple containers. Containers comfortably fit 10,15,20 and 25 pieces. For more than than I would suggest using multiple containers. For best results, store problems flat one by one.
